Jake Paul Defeats MMA Legend Anderson Silva, Internet Feels The Match Was Unjust

YouTuber-turned-professional boxer, Jake Paul defeated MMA veteran Anderson ‘The Spider’ Silva on Saturday night to maintain his unbeaten streak. The pay-per-view clash was the major highlight of a Showtime PPV from the US’ Desert Diamond.

The 25-year-old social media influencer made sure his youth triumphed over the experience of 47-year-old Silva in just his sixth professional fight, which was also perhaps the most important of his career.
The match sparked an outpouring of responses on social media, as was predicted. The majority of users, however, immediately began discussing the age gap between the two fighters after it was finished. Due to the two fighters’ glaring 22-year age difference, many found the bout to be unjust.

Paul won a unanimous decision by out-boxing Silva and coming back for a knockdown in the last round. He defeated Anderson twice with 77-74 and 78-73 to win the game.
Paul attacked in Round 1 while Silva began on defence. Silva threw several effective punches despite his comparatively older age in practically every round. Silva began to exhibit indications of ageing and exhaustion by Round 7. Then, as he tried to intimidate Paul, a strong right hand struck him, knocking him to the ground.
